I am now chasing a new problem. Symptons are as follows:
Truck idles fine.
When driving, at certain running speeds say around 1700 rpm, the truck surges. It is like the injectors is turning on and off. Then it will stumble. It will also do that when the cruise is on while traveling a flat road. It will speed up (surge) and then slow down (stumble).
I am thinking of one of two things. Either the fuel pump or that damn CPS.

Injection pressure regulator controls the oil pressure in the heads which fires the injectors. If the IPR is opening and closing a little while driving it can make the engine surge or fall off since the injectors use this oil to fire.
